With the mid-range QBSE Tax Bundle edition, you also have the option to pay your quarterly taxes directly from QuickBooks and transfer all of your information to TurboTax when tax season rolls around. With the QBSE Live Tax Bundle plan, you can consult a CPA in real time if you get stuck and have them give your tax return a final review to make sure all of your bases are covered.
However, if you want more accounting features, including sales tax tracking and cash flow management, QuickBooks Online might be a better fit. In general, we recommend QuickBooks Online over QuickBooks Self-Employed, even for freelancers. QuickBooks Online costs more, but it also offers more thorough invoicing and additional insight into your cash flow.

Among the many handy accounting features of QBSE, automatic mileage tracking might be the most unique. From a tax perspective, the IRS lets you deduct miles driven for business purposes—but you had better be prepared to back up your claim in the event of an audit. Most business owners start the year with the best intentions of accurately tracking business mileage, but they wind up giving their best guess at tax time and crossing their fingers. You can tell QuickBooks that deposits from a specific client should always be marked business income, for example, or that transactions at Staples should always be designated as business office expenses. Rules can be applied retroactively, and you can also mark a specific bank account as “mostly business” to take some of the legwork out of organizing your books. No need to manually calculate mileage deductions for every work-related trip. QuickBooks Solopreneur will automatically do the math for you using the current IRS mileage rate. Just opt into mileage tracking via the app to automatically log all of your car travel. QuickBooks keeps a running tally of business miles and the corresponding deduction.
Business and personal expenses are automatically sorted into categories, so you can track your spending and maximize tax deductions. The app uses your phone’s GPS capabilities to automatically track your mileage when you start driving, and it creates a discrete trip when you stop. The app then prompts you to designate that trip as personal or business and, if business, to identify its purpose. No more need to reconstruct your travels in a panic every year on April 14.
